Many people in public health, science, and health care are concerned about the Trump Administration’s massive and indiscriminate cuts in the Centers for Disease Control and Prevention (the CDC ), the National Institutes of Health (NIH). and other departments under the Health and Human Services, as well as the suspension of federal scientific review panels, removal of publicly available data from federal health-related websites and other actions that are likely to endanger the public’s health in the short and long terms. But what does the public think of these significant changes? Are they even aware of them? HealthCetera producer and host Dr. Diana Mason, RN, talks with Dr. Rebekah H. Nagler, an Associate Professor at the Hubbard School of Journalism & Mass Communication at the University of Minnesota, about a survey she conducted that sought to answer these questions. The results were published by the Milbank Memorial Fund on April 25th. This interview first aired on HealthCetera in the Catskills on WIOX Radio on April 30, 2025.
